Natural Disorder is a fascinating dive into the life of Jacob Nossell, a young man navigating the complexities of living with a congenital brain paralysis. The film carries a raw authenticity that feels almost intimate, capturing Jacob’s struggles with speech and movement, yet it also showcases his sharp intelligence and humor. The pacing is deliberate, allowing viewers to truly soak in his experiences and thoughts, making it quite immersive. What sets this documentary apart is its unflinching portrayal of disability – not just as a challenge, but as part of Jacob's identity. The practical effects are minimal, but the realness of Jacob's world comes through in every frame, creating a poignant atmosphere that lingers long after viewing.
